The following new foreign Heads of Mission presented their diplomatic credentials to President S R Nathan in separate ceremonies at the Istana today:
(a) The Ambassador of the State of Israel, Mr Ilan Ben-Dov, who has succeeded Mr Itzhak Shoham;
(b) The Ambassador of the Kingdom of the Netherlands, Mr Christiaan Cornelis Sanders, who has succeeded Mr Hendrik Jan Van Pesch; and
(c) The Ambassador of the Republic of Hungary, Mr Tamas Magda, who has succeeded Dr Gyorgy Nanovfszky.
The curricula vitae of Mr Ilan Ben-Dov, Mr Christiaan Cornelis Sanders and Mr Tamas Magda are attached.
